New Delhi- The Joint Seat Allocation Authority (JoSAA) will release the round 2 JoSAA seat allotment result on September 28, 2022. The result will be announced on the official website, josaa.nic.in. Candidates will have to provide their JEE Mains 2022 application number and password in order to access the JoSAA round 2 seat allotment results. The candidates who will be allocated seats should upload their documents online and pay the required seat acceptance fees. During the admission process, the JoSAA seat allotment 2022 letter, along with the other documents, should be provided to the institute. JoSAA 2022 Round 2 Seat Allotment Dates
The following table includes a list of all important dates related to round 2 seat allotment-
Events | Dates |
---|---|
JoSAA Round 2 Seat Allotment | September 28, 2022 |
Online reporting | September 28, 2022 to October 01, 2022 |
Last Date of Responding to query | October 02, 2022 |
Seat Withdrawal | September 29, 2022 to October 02, 2022 |
Important Instructions For JoSAA 2022 Round 2 Seat Allotment and Reporting Process
The following are some important instructions for the JoSAA 2022 Round 2:
Important Instructions for JoSAA 2022 Seat Allotment
- Candidates who are allotted a seat based on their first preference will not be able to use the Float & Slide option. They can either Freeze or Withdraw
- The candidates will have to pay a seat acceptance fee of Rs. 35,000 (General) or Rs. 15,000 (Reserved), in order to accept the seat
- Candidates, should upload the required documents that are required in order to complete the JoSAA seat acceptance process
- The Float & Slide option will be available to those who did not get the college of their first choice. Such applicants will also have to pay a seat acceptance fee
- For candidates who have chosen the float option will have to go through dual reporting

Important Instructions for JoSAA 2022 Reporting Process
- The first step is to upload the required documents. If there is a problem in the documents, candidates will be notified the same by email or SMS
- Once the candidates upload and submit their documents, the seat allotment slip will be generated
- Candidates will have to report in person to their particular reporting center for document verification after online reporting
